Problem
Existing fittings and collars for tubes exhibit inconsistent holding strength, leading to potential permanent failures under load.
Innovation Solution
A composite collar with a fiber-reinforced design, featuring axially oriented fibers and a tapered inner surface, is used to apply a consistent radial compressive force to the tube, ensuring a secure connection by pressing the collar onto the tube with a predetermined axial load.

Engineering Contradiction Analysis
1Reliability
If a traditional collar is used to clamp the tube to the fitting, then the assembly is simple to manufacture and install, but the holding strength between the tube and fitting is inconsistent leading to permanent failures
Solution Approach 1:
The collar is constructed from composite materials with fibers oriented in specific patterns (axial fibers in the tapered section, hoop fibers in the cylindrical section) to provide consistent mechanical properties and predictable load distribution, resolving the inconsistency in holding strength while maintaining structural integrity
Solution Approach 2:
Different sections of the collar have different fiber orientations and material properties tailored to their specific functions: the tapered section uses axial fibers for load transfer, while the cylindrical section uses hoop fibers for circumferential support, creating locally optimized performance that ensures consistent holding strength
2Reliability
If a fiber reinforced composite collar with axially oriented fibers is used, then consistent holding strength is achieved, but the manufacturing process becomes more complex
Solution Approach 1:
The collar is divided into distinct sections (tapered section with axial fibers, cylindrical section with hoop fibers) that can be manufactured separately and then assembled, allowing each section to be optimized for its specific function while simplifying the overall manufacturing process through modular construction
Solution Approach 2:
The collar design incorporates specific geometric parameters (taper angle, section lengths, fiber orientations) that are optimized to achieve consistent holding strength, with the fiber orientation angles and section dimensions carefully controlled to ensure predictable mechanical behavior under load
